Security concerns over Russia bring back the Iron Rhine
The Iron Rhine, the railway that links Belgium’s port of Antwerp to Germany’s Ruhr region, dates back to the 19th century but has been largely unused since the end of World War II. According to a Belga News Agency report, Belgium, the Netherlands, and Germany are accelerating talks to restart the rail line amid increasing security concerns over Russia.
